I tend to agree with your comment but I'm unsure about one thing:
With this mindset it also makes sense to differentiate the lookup functions, so we have something like: FindEvents(...filters...) FindItems(...filters...)
Maybe I'm just misunderstanding that, but if you imply that FindEvents would only return a reference to the item (eg., it wouldn't have the URI, title nor anything else of that) I don't think that makes much practical sense. Ie., that information is required almost always and having to do two calls to get it is inconvenient; I'd like to keep the API as simple as possible (but I agree that indeed it isn't ideal right now). -- Siegfried-Angel Gevatter Pujals (RainCT) Ubuntu Developer. Debian Contributor.
Description: OpenPGP digital signature
_______________________________________________ Mailing list: https://launchpad.net/~zeitgeist Post to : firstname.lastname@example.org Unsubscribe : https://launchpad.net/~zeitgeist More help : https://help.launchpad.net/ListHelp